    Is there any way to smooth out the contour? It looks kind of jagged on the soft materials.

    Nice results, guys.

    @Sevasti: Well, you can use the eraser tool with a small brush to remove some of the jagged pieces. However, it is indeed a somewhat tedious job and might well take a while. You could also try duplicating your object's layer to make the outline sharper and smoother. But despite that, your second try looks very good already. For signatures, avatars and wallpapers it will be edited further or possibly even scaled down anyway so I wouldn't worry too much.

    Quote Originally Posted by Templar Hospitaller View Post
    How do you get the lines so smooth?
    I zoomed in to 800x and lassoed it after clearing out internal spaces. Then i pasted and anchored it onto an alpha background for transparency.

    Course Sections

    1. April 25 - May 2: A basic overview of the program and getting to know the first few of the GIMP's many features.
    2. May 2 - May 9: Creating your own avatar, scaling images, adding borders, and more.
    3. May 9 - May 16: Making a signature from scratch. Includes for example fading techniques, blending and working with text.
    4. May 16 - May 23: Create a wallpaper or banner by utilizing everything we have learned so far. Simple animations will probably also be featured.
